Unlike some resources that jump into configuration, Molenaar typically begins with network theory (e.g., BGP path selection algorithm) and then maps each theoretical step to Cisco IOS commands. This suits the CCNP ENCOR exam, which tests both theory and implementation.

The CCNP certification is designed for networking professionals who are looking to validate their skills in implementing, securing, and troubleshooting network solutions. It covers a broad range of topics including routing, switching, security, wireless, and collaboration.
